Minymo
Best for Adventurous Kids | Minymo
Nordic design is all about comfort and understated style and Minymo’s collection of everyday essentials do just that. Perfect for the active and adventurous child, the Danish brand’s well-designed pieces are wardrobe staples. The brand champions sustainable materials by using organic cotton, bamboo and viscose throughout their collection, all recognised with the OEKO-TEX®, GOTS and BIONIC FINISH® ECO certifications. In muted tones which are in keeping with their planet-friendly ethos, the super soft and easy-to-move-in essentials will keep kids comfortable for hours of play in the great outdoors.
